About this object

A partly glazed porcelain figurine of a milkmaid dressed in an empire costume, a white blouse and a long blue dress trimmed in tooled gold. She wears a finely tooled gilt kokoshnik upon her head, across her shoulders is a balance imitating wood for carrying two milk buckets. Base is painted brown and green with gold around rim.
